关于delete删除select查询出来的结果怎么做
发布网友
发布时间:2022-10-14 08:07
我来回答
共2个回答
热心网友
时间:2024-12-04 07:05
--假设有表A,并且有个主键列C1--删除查询出来的行DELETE [A] WHERE C1 IN( --查询出来的信息 SELECT C1 FROM [A] WHERE 条件)
热心网友
时间:2024-12-04 07:06
delete from 表名 where (select 要查询的热条件 from emp)
MySQL使用delete删除select查询出来的结果
DEELETE FROM db_table where datelogin < "2019-01-01"
...使用delete 语句删除表中记录后,用select语句看到被删记录仍以空的...
1.删除语句有问题 2.存在触发器,Delete触发后重新插入了数据
SQL用查询分析器查询出来的数据如何删除
能查出来 应该是能删除呀 比如要删除 select from tbYourTable where cName like '%零度信息港%'的结果,则删除语句应该为:delete from tbyourTable where cName like '%零度信息港%'不知道你遇到的是不是这样的问题~
mysqldelete语法使用详细解析
1. 基本语法结构:DELETE FROM 表名称 WHERE 条件;如果没有WHERE子句,所有记录将被删除。例如:DELETE FROM 表名称将会删除指定表中的所有记录。请注意在执行这样的操作前务必做好备份,避免数据丢失。2. 使用条件删除记录:当知道要删除的确切条件时,可以使用WHERE子句来指定条件。例如,要删除所有年龄...
SQL中,怎样删除从多个表查询到的记录
SQL查询结果不能删除啊,因为它根本不是一个实体表。如要在查询结果中进行再次查询比较将会更好,如 查询年龄大于30岁月且月收入超过3000元的 上海人:select * from (select a.姓名,a.籍贯,b.年龄,c.收入 from a1 a,b1 b2,c1 c where a.cust_id=b.cust_id and b.serv_id=c.serv_id...
SQL删除指定数据库中的某个表中的某行语句
1、首先,我们利用Select查询一下表中的所有数据,显示在这里我们可以看到。2、接下来,我们输入关键字,这个关键字就是delete。3、然后在关键字紧接着的地方,我们输入表的名称,一定要存在。4、然后我们输入Where,后面紧跟着条件,这个方法在其他地方使用相同。5、如果SQL语句有多行的,或者有其他不...
oracle如何删除查询到的数据
有id好说 delete from 2_2 WHERE id in (select id from 1_1)没有就比较麻烦 delete from 2_2 where exists (select 1 from 1_1 where 1_1.所有项目=2_2.所有项目)
MySQL删除查询的实现方法mysql中删除查询
DELETE FROM users WHERE age > 30;以上语句将删除表users中所有年龄大于30的用户数据。2. 使用SELECT INTO OUTFILE语句 MySQL还提供了SELECT INTO OUTFILE语句,它可以将查询结果输出到一个文件中。这种方法可以更好地控制输出的内容,而且支持多种格式。首先需要创建一个用于保存输出结果的文件。例如:SEL...
查询到的结果怎么编辑修改?
删除要执行删除的语句 delete from ZY_FLSF where 字段名字 like '%小张%'这个就是把字段名字这个字段中含有小张的全删掉了,慎重删除
SQL delete语句使用
SQL中的DELETE语句通常用于从表中删除符合条件的记录,其中级联查询是一种常见的用法。在使用这种查询时,你首先要从表2中选择出与表1中某个字段相匹配的记录,然后基于这些匹配记录删除表1中的对应项。例如:sql DELETE FROM 表1 WHERE 字段 IN (SELECT * FROM 表2 WHERE 表1.字段 = 表2.字段)...